Transaction 44aaf629896765a8e58a6e908daa70c94c7ae5895849bf83a2a24f6dbc82f718
1 Input
2 Outputs
- 44aaf629896765a8e58a6e908daa70c94c7ae5895849bf83a2a24f6dbc82f718:0
- 44aaf629896765a8e58a6e908daa70c94c7ae5895849bf83a2a24f6dbc82f718:1
value 3071800
address 3225zQr8E73tSiGguUK8dhnTvChks1o6sR
value 19825094
address 3FVXHAZxRoG2XfXgKxqDKbAkKWtFmZK5ki